Output cd7453b16d1a2bf675ed13b6e17f217fb9f0ba846349052998b81c350876f9e6:35

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c59581e0b49e9143eac991660b21d510be2c89a4482f1d52d61ad5306b49f41
address
bc1p33v4s8stf853g04vnytxpvsa2y979jy6gjp0r4fdvxk4xp45naqs0q3gk3
transaction
cd7453b16d1a2bf675ed13b6e17f217fb9f0ba846349052998b81c350876f9e6
spent
true